First Tennessee recently promoted Richard Carnes to vice president and collections operations manager in its default servicing division.
Carnes is a graduate of Ohio State University where he received his B.A. Carnes received his masters from the University of Tennessee. He joined First Tennessee in 2002 and leads a collection team to reduce losses on $12 Billion Consumer Loan Portfolio, minimizing risk to the bank. Carnes resides in Friendsville with his wife Elithe Carnes and is an active community volunteer working with Kairos, Habitat for Humanity, Greenback Food Pantry and other organizations.
